A company makes a profit when it brings in more money
Rom4ik [11]

Answer: There are 1490 items must be sold for the company to make a profit.

Explanation:

Since we have given that

R(x)=220x\\\\C(x)=190x+44700

So, According to question, we get :

Profit=R(x)-C(x)\\\\Profit=220x-(190x+44700)\\\\Profit=30x-44700

As  we know that

P(x)=0\\\\30x-44700=0\\\\30x=44700\\\\x=\dfrac{44700}{30}\\\\x=1490

So, there are 1490 items must be sold for the company to make a profit.
